Have you ever felt stuck, knowing deep down that you're capable of so much more? This feeling is universal, yet few people understand how to bridge the gap between current reality and untapped potential. Growth doesn't just happen-it requires deliberate choice and consistent action. When John Maxwell was 24, a simple question changed his trajectory forever: "Do you have a plan for your personal growth?" He didn't-despite his accomplishments, he had never considered intentional development. Most of us fall into what Maxwell calls "growth gaps"-misconceptions that prevent our progress. We assume we'll grow automatically with time, don't know how to grow, wait for the "perfect moment," fear making mistakes, search endlessly for the "best way," wait to "feel like" growing, get intimidated by others' success, or quit when growth proves challenging. The difference between accidental and intentional growth is profound. Accidental growth is passive, relies on luck, and eventually plateaus. Intentional growth takes responsibility, learns from mistakes, perseveres through challenges, and never stops evolving. To overcome growth barriers, ask yourself "How far can I go?"-not to find a definitive answer but to set direction. Embrace urgency by saying "do it now" rather than postponing growth. Face your fears by recognizing that everyone has both fear and faith-whichever emotion you feed becomes stronger. As Eleanor Roosevelt wisely noted, "One's philosophy is not best expressed in words; it is expressed in the choices one makes." Your growth journey begins with the intentional choice to pursue it.
